Latka Spikes the River to Triple; Nelson Eliminated;

Level 26 : Blinds 40,000/80,000, 80,000 ante

There was three-way all in action preflop, with Jeffrey Latka at risk for 700,000 from the small blind, Chris Nelson at risk for just over 600,000 from early position, and Erik Gault from middle position who had both players covered.

Chris Nelson: AQ All in
Jeffrey Latka: AK
Erik Gault: 1010

The J95 flop kept the tens in the lead, and the 10 turn was a sweaty card, giving Gault a set, while Latka picked up the better flush draw.

The river was the 3, giving Latka the winner with a king-high flush, while Nelson was eliminated.

Shortly before the hand, Tal Ron was eliminated after getting his short stack into the middle with K6, falling to the Q3 of Osterbauer for about three and a half blinds.

Finally, at a third table, Jonathan Roeder and Aydan Saunders were tangled in a pot with the completed board reading 108239. On the river, Saunders check-called a bet of 1,500,000 from Roeder, only to be shown 99 for a set, leaving Saunders with 50,000.
